Highlights
The vibrant and exciting city of Lille is a rising star. The old town centre, known as Vieux-Lille, is a stunning jewel of grand Flemish architecture, with renouned art museums, cobbled streets and leafy parks just waiting to be explored.
At the heart of Vieux-Lille is its beautiful Grand Place, once the medieval market place. You will be dropped off and picked up a few minutes walk from this popular gathering place. Its decorative brick houses, ornate Vieille Bourse and pavement brasseries around the fountain of the Déesse – the goddess said to have saved the town when it was besieged by Austria in 1792 – are elegant and picturesque. A short walk from here you’ll find Lille’s 17th century star-shaped Citadelle. Outside it’s 2.2km long ramparts is the city’s largest park, home to a small zoo and amusement park.
With Christmas approaching, Lille is decked out in lights and colour. Around the Christmas market, the whole town is covered in a huge crown of garlands.
On Place Rihour, 80 wooden chalets teem with gift ideas, nativity figurines, Christmas decorations and festive food. You can find regional specialities here, and you can also find arts and crafts from Russia, Canada and Poland! And that's not to forget the gingerbread and other delicacies, which you can take away or eat on the spot with a glass of mulled wine...
